Bibliographic description
xii, 308p. [ii] . ill.. (woodcuts) . 12mo.. Second state of this edition with index. Provenance: Bookplate: 'From the Bewick collection of the Rev. Thomas Hugo, and described in The Bewick Collector, no. 24';inscribed by Hugo:'This is the finest copy of Saints edition of the Select Fables I ever saw - I purchased it from Mr. John Bell of Gateshead who was one of Bewick's chums'; also leather bookplate: Sinclair Hamilton. Loose print from block engraved by John Bewick for the frontispiece of this book; also bookplate on p. ii: John Bell.. Binding: original blind tooled calf binding with gilt border.
